Elder Abuse is a widespread, under-reported issue in our state. This training is designed to provide practical information that will aid in the investigation and prosecution of elder abuse cases. Attendees will leave this training with a better understanding of the issues surrounding elder abuse as well as strategies for how to effectively investigate and prosecute these cases.


Topics Covered:

  • Responding to At-Risk Adult Abuse
  • Financial Crimes
  • APS and Social Services
  • Prosecuting Elder & Disabled Adult Cases
  • Alzheimer's and Dementia and How to Respond


This is an in-person training and there will not be a webinar option. It offers 6 CLE and POST hours and 4 Victim Advocate hours.
